Hoodlums on rampage, kill three loot shops in MINNA.
FROM SAMSON ALFA, MINNA.
    Bearly few days after Governor Umar Bago of Niger state declared a state of emergency on thuggery, Maitumbi town a suburb in MINNA last Friday was engulfed by youth restiveness, three people killed,six Shops vandalised properties worth Millions of Naira carted away.
      The reports indicates that the youth restiveness has become an annual occurrence particularly at Maitumbi as hundreds of hoodlums converged at flamingo junction in pretence of fighting, but were operating freely broke into Shops for over two hours.
    Shops affected during the attack includes the shops of an auto mechanic,refrigerator mechanic, provision shop and a Shop of second hand ladies bags and shoes also containing minerals of various brands were carted away and cash by the hoodlums, seized handsets of passerby mostly passengers in tricycles plying Maitumbi Mobile road.
   According to the report the incidence which started at the Mining site behind Flamingo Estate Maitumbi one, Mrs Alofetekun, the  wife of late Akin Alofetekun of the Guardian Newspaper was attacked until about 10:30 pm of  Friday the  crisis escalated to the Flamingo Junction maitumbi and lasted for saveral hours as shops were looted at will.
    The sources added that three people were reportedly killed with several others Injured,also properties that includes cars,motorcycles, tricycles,were destroyed by the youths who used dangerous weapons, stones, cutlasses, bottles,machete, knives to carryout their nefarious activities in the area.
    We gathered that the security personnel at the scene have no option than to fold their hands to save their life from the antics of the hoodlums,as any action taken will not be taken with kids gloves compare to their population at the scene.
   Sources  disclosed that such nefarious acts has become an annual decimal at every sallah celebrations there is always youth restiveness,making innocent citizens to be victims were either killed,injured, their  properties looted and are not usually compensated by either the state or local governments.
    One of the victim, Mrs Alofetekun the wife of the late Correspondent of Guardian newspaper in Niger state Akin Alofetekun, said she was in Maitumbi uphill for special prayers session where her car was completely destroyed by the hoodlums.
    In an interview with some affected victims names  withheld express their fear over the looted  properties, according to them they have been confronted with similar attacks over the years but nothing good have come out of it,”we are handicapped, hopeless  for now on this matter.”
    Contacted, the Niger state police command Public Relations Officer, SP Wasiu Abiodun confirmed that two persons were killed and 6 suspects arrested in connection with the incident while the police is  still monitoring to apprehend other suspects.
